One Year Bible: Day 181 - 2 Kings 1:1-2:25; Acts 20:1-38; Psalm 78:40-55
“Where now is the Lord, the God of Elijah?” (2 Kings 2:14).
With each succeeding generation, God is looking for those who will
commit themselves to the task of testifying to the Gospel of God’s
grace” (Acts 20:24). “He brought His people out like a flock; He led them like sheep through the desert” (Psalm 78:52).
How does God do this in this generation? – He works through those who
give faithful testimony to the Gospel of His grace. He works through
those do not hesitate “to proclaim … the whole will of God” (Acts 20:27). He works through those who call on men and women to “turn to God in repentance and have faith in our Lord Jesus” (Acts 20:21).
